Two police officers stabbed by extremist near Parliament in Tunisia


(MENAFN) An Islamic extremist stabbed two police officers on Wednesday near the headquarters of Tunisia's Parliament, the authorities said, describing it as an unusually bold attack that disturbed the capital.

The authorities said that the 25-year-old attacker was known to them for radicalism, thus, he was immediately arrested, according to a statement by the Interior Ministry.

One of the officers was transferred to the intensive care unit of the nearest hospital after being stabbed in the neck, whilst the other rushed to back him and was stabbed in the forehead, thankfully the injury was not severe, the Interior ministry said.
